Engraving Love's Fingerprint: A Guide to Capturing Personal Touch with Laser Marking Machines

In the world of jewelry, the personal touch is everything. It's what transforms a piece from a simple adornment into a cherished symbol of love and commitment. One of the most intimate and unique ways to personalize wedding rings is by engraving the fingerprints of both partners. This article will guide you through the process of using a Laser marking machine to etch these irreplaceable marks onto the bands of matrimony.

The Power of Personalization

Personalization in jewelry is not just a trend; it's a tradition that adds depth and meaning to the piece. A Laser marking machine offers precision and versatility, allowing for intricate designs and detailed engravings that are perfect for capturing the unique patterns of fingerprints.

Choosing the Right Laser Marking Machine

Not all Laser marking machines are created equal. For engraving fingerprints on wedding bands, you'll want a machine that offers high-resolution and fine control over the engraving process. Look for a machine that has:

- A small spot size for detailed work
- Adjustable power settings to prevent over-etching or damaging the metal
- A stable and precise stage for holding the ring in place during the engraving process

Preparation

Before you begin the engraving process, you'll need a high-quality image of the fingerprints. This can be obtained through a scanner or a high-resolution photograph. The image should be clear and sharp to ensure that the engraving captures every detail of the fingerprint.

Setting Up the Laser Marking Machine

Once you have your fingerprint image, it's time to set up the Laser marking machine. Import the image into the machine's software and adjust the size and position to fit the ring's surface. Make sure to:

- Calibrate the machine to ensure accurate engraving
- Set the appropriate power and speed settings for the metal of the ring
- Secure the ring in the machine's stage to prevent movement during engraving

Engraving the Fingerprints

With everything set up, you can now begin the engraving process. The Laser marking machine will trace the fingerprint image onto the ring's surface, etching the design into the metal. It's important to:

- Monitor the engraving process to ensure the design is being accurately transferred
- Pause and adjust the settings if needed to avoid over-etching or under-etching

Post-Engraving Care

After the engraving is complete, carefully remove the ring from the machine and inspect the engraving for quality and accuracy. If necessary, you can make touch-ups or re-engrave areas that need more detail.

Conclusion

Engraving fingerprints onto wedding rings is a beautiful way to symbolize the union of two individuals. With a Laser marking machine, this process can be done with precision and care, ensuring that each ring bears a unique and personal mark of love. As with any jewelry customization, it's essential to work with a skilled professional and a high-quality machine to achieve the best results.
